That's the rule of thumb I use too.

For anyone not familiar, 8 bits = 1 Byte, so if you divide by 8 as an absolute, but then factor in the protocol handshaking, latency of propagation etc, dividing by 10 is a good rule of thumb.

There's been a bit of talk on here about internet performance over recent weeks, and my experience seems to be DNS look up table delays more than actual throughput. I have a cable (not fibre) 30Mbit package (via "True" lol), and I wonder sometimes if it's not the connection that is the issue, but that sites like torrents aren't able to deliver, and capacity is left spare (or at least capacity internal to Thailand rather than International). The best results seem to come from not only having lots of seeders, but also lack of demand (i.e. not the latest movie, but maybe last years glory production).
